WHERE子句是结构化查询语言(SQL)中用于过滤数据的关键字之一。它允许我们在查询中指定条件,以限制返回的结果集。
在使用LIKE操作符时,WHERE子句可以对另一个表中某列的所有数据进行模糊匹配查询。LIKE操作符通常与通配符一起使用,以匹配满足特定模式的数据。
答案示例:
WHERE子句对另一个表中某列的所有数据使用LIKE的SQL查询,可以通过以下步骤实现:
例如,假设我们有一个名为"products"的表,其中包含一个"product_name"列,我们想要查询所有产品名称中包含"手机"的记录,可以使用以下查询:
SELECT * FROM products WHERE product_name LIKE '%手机%'
在上面的查询中,%是一个通配符,表示可以匹配任意字符(包括零个字符)。所以'%手机%'将匹配包含任意字符加上"手机"加上任意字符的产品名称。
此外,可以使用以下通配符来进一步定义模式:
以下是使用腾讯云的产品来解释上述内容的示例:
假设我们使用腾讯云的云数据库MySQL来存储产品数据,并使用腾讯云的云服务器CVM来运行我们的应用程序。我们可以在腾讯云的官方文档中找到关于这些产品的详细信息和使用指南。
请注意,此回答仅提供了一个示例,实际情况可能因环境、需求和技术选择而有所不同。
领取专属 10元无门槛券
手把手带您无忧上云